Brooks Memorial State Park is in Goldendale, WA 98620. The available information identifies it as a campground and park, but no specific camping type or on-site facilities are verified in the provided facts. The campground has a Google rating of 4.2 out of 5 stars.
Review excerpts mention hiking trails and horse riding trails, including some sections that are wide enough for riding side by side and other sections that are more difficult or single track. One review also notes that the trails are being worked on to make them easier to follow. Another excerpt mentions a meadow at the top of a hill with a view of Mt. Hood, along with picnic tables in that area. A separate review says the park has disc golf and lots of hiking trails.
The reviews also describe trail footing as generally soft, while noting that some gravel parts could be difficult for a tender-footed horse. One reviewer specifically recommends protective hoof wear for horses that are sensitive to rocks. Another review says the park is closed in the summer, and one excerpt mentions that bathrooms are very clean. The same excerpt also notes road noise from the nearby highway until late in the evening.
Based on the verified information, Brooks Memorial State Park may suit visitors looking for trails, horse riding, disc golf, and picnic tables. The available facts do not verify additional campground amenities.
